Detalles del Curso

โ€ข Introduction to Laser Metal Cutting: Understanding the basics, principles, and advantages of laser metal cutting technology.
โ€ข AI in Laser Metal Cutting: Exploring the role of artificial intelligence in optimizing laser metal cutting processes.
โ€ข AI-Driven Efficiency Enhancements: Utilizing AI algorithms to improve efficiency in laser metal cutting, including real-time adaptive control and predictive maintenance.
โ€ข Machine Learning for Metal Cutting: Applying machine learning techniques to analyze and predict laser metal cutting outcomes, enabling data-driven decision-making.
โ€ข Advanced AI-Assisted Laser Systems: Investigating cutting-edge AI-enhanced laser systems for increased precision, speed, and energy efficiency.
โ€ข AI-Driven Quality Control in Metal Cutting: Implementing AI solutions for in-process monitoring and defect detection in laser metal cutting.
โ€ข AI-Based Process Modeling and Simulation: Leveraging AI to create accurate models and simulations of laser metal cutting processes.
โ€ข Sustainability in Laser Metal Cutting with AI: Evaluating the potential of AI to reduce energy consumption and waste in laser metal cutting.
โ€ข Industry 4.0 and AI Adoption: Exploring the integration of AI and laser metal cutting in the context of Industry 4.0 smart factories.
